What AI systems can do for your business

AI tools can support many day-to-day tasks that usually require constant attention. Once configured properly, they can work around the clock and keep your operations consistent even when your team is busy or unavailable.

Scheduling made simple

AI can help customers book appointments, request time slots, and get matched with available openings automatically. It can also reduce double-bookings and make sure your calendar stays updated in real time.

  • Book new appointments automatically
  • Offer available time slots based on your schedule
  • Update calendars without manual entry
  • Reduce missed bookings and scheduling errors

Automatic confirmations

Once an appointment is booked, AI can send confirmations right away. That means customers know their request went through, and your team does not need to spend time sending the same message again and again.

  • Send instant booking confirmations
  • Share appointment details clearly
  • Keep customers informed without extra work

Friendly reminder systems

No-shows can be a real headache. AI reminder systems help cut them down by sending alerts before appointments, service visits, or scheduled calls. Reminders can be timed in a way that fits your business and your customers.

  • Remind customers before appointments
  • Send follow-up alerts automatically
  • Lower no-show rates and last-minute cancellations

Customer coordination support

AI can also help coordinate communication between your business and your customers. Whether it is collecting basic details, answering simple questions, or passing the right information to your staff, automation keeps things organized and moving.

  • Answer common customer questions
  • Collect lead and booking details
  • Route requests to the right person or department
  • Keep conversations consistent and easy to track

Getting started with AI automation

If you are thinking about automating scheduling, reminders, and customer coordination, it helps to start with the areas that take up the most time. That usually gives you the fastest return and makes the transition easier for your team.

Step 1: Identify repetitive tasks

Look at the work your team handles every day. If a task is repeated often and does not require much judgment, it is probably a good candidate for automation.

Step 2: Choose the right tools

Not every AI system is built the same. You want something that works well with your existing process and actually solves problems instead of creating new ones.

Step 3: Set clear rules and messages

Good automation needs clear instructions. Confirmations, reminders, and customer responses should match your tone, timing, and business needs.

Step 4: Review and improve

Once the system is live, keep an eye on how it performs. Small adjustments can make a big difference in how smoothly everything runs.
